Jasmine essential oil is
extracted from Jasminum
Gradiflora (synonym
officinale), of the Oleaceae
family and is also known as
Jasmin, Jessamine and
common Jasmine.
Jasmine is an evergreen,
fragile, climbing shrub, that
can grow up to 10 meters
(33 feet) high and has dark
green leaves and small white
star-shaped flowers, which
are picked at night, when the
aroma is most intense.
An experienced picker
can pick 10,000-15,000
blossoms per night.
Originally from China and
Northern India, it was brought
to Spain by the Moors, with
France, Italy, Morocco, Egypt,
China, Japan and Turkey
currently producing the best
essential oil.
The name Jasmine is
derived from the Persian
word 'yasmin'. The Chinese,
Arabians and Indians used it
medicinally, as well as for an
aphrodisiac and for other
ceremonial purposes.
In Turkey, the wood is
used for making rope stems
and jasmine tea is a Chinese
favorite (but Jasminum
sambac - Arabian jasmine - is
normally used for this) and
in Indonesia it is used as a
popular garnish.
